KUKA.Sim Pro is an advanced simulation software developed by KUKA for offline programming, layout design, and cycle time analysis of robotic workcells. Installing and activating KUKA.Sim Pro 2.0 (or newer versions like 4.x) requires a precise sequence of steps to ensure the software communicates correctly with the licensing server and your virtual robot controllers.
